What is a Mine Roller?

A mine roller is a crucial piece of demining equipment typically attached to the front of armoured vehicles like tanks or personnel carriers. Its primary function is to detonate victim activated devices including  landmines and Improvised Explosive Devices (IEDs), thereby verifying a safe passage through a suspected minefield or high threat route. This allows engineers and other personnel to proceed with further clearance efforts or military manoeuvres with greater confidence.

Mine rollers consist of multiple heavy-duty wheels either manufactured from high grade steel or polyurethane.  These rollers provide

  • Increased Ground Pressure bu significantly enhancing the pressure exerted on the ground surface. This heightened pressure ensures the detonation of pressure-activated devices commonly employed in minefields.
  • Victim-Operated IEDs (VOIED) Activation: The design facilitates the triggering of VOIEDs, including landmines detonated by a tripwire or other victim-operated mechanisms. The Armtrac Mine Roller, for instance, is specifically deployed in situations where the presence of a VOIED is possible , and not a certainty.

Key Benefits of Mine Rollers

  • Enhanced Protection: Mine rollers act as a vanguard for the armoured vehicle, shielding the crew and nearby civilians from the impact of a mine detonation.
  • Efficiency and Speed: Mine rollers enable the rapid verification of routes and large areas compared to manual clearance techniques.
  • Force Generation: The system can exert significant weight (up to 4000 kg) onto the wheels, guaranteeing sufficient force to trigger even deeply buried pressure-activated devices.
  • Operational Flexibility: When not actively clearing a route, the rollers can be raised, offering greater ground clearance for improved vehicle speed and manoeuvrability.
  • Steering Capability: The Mine rollers can be steered in various directions, allowing for the negotiation of moderate corners while ensuring complete coverage of the ground ahead. 
  • Terrain Versatility: Mine rollers are designed to function effectively across diverse terrain types.
  • Modular Design: In the event of a mine blast, the damage is typically confined to the roller itself, which is a readily replaceable component. Even in the case of a more substantial explosion, the roller bank is engineered to detach from the main frame at a designated weak point. This modular design facilitates swift repairs and minimizes downtime.
